In an interesting twist, it was not Captain Barbossa who killed Bootstrap Bill Turner. Although he did strap a cannon to Bootstrap's bootstraps and tossed him overboard, Bill was a (reluctant) member of the cursed crew, and probably the first to discover that he couldn't die while on his way to the bottom of the ocean. The ending thus suggests that when his own son Will Turner lifted the curse, Bill finally died by drowning or getting crushed by water pressure. However, in Pirati dei Caraibi - La maledizione del forziere fantasma (2006) we learn that Davy Jones had already offered Bill a place in his crew to free him from both his entrapment and the Aztek curse. So, when Will would have caused his death by returning the piece of gold with his blood to the chest, Bill was actually protected by Davy Jones's contract.
